一、核心功能设计
1. 用户端功能
- 下单系统:
- 商品/服务选择(支持分类、搜索、推荐)
- 配送地址管理(自动定位、历史地址保存)
- 配送时间预约(即时/预约时段)
- 支付集成(微信/支付宝/银联等)
- 订单追踪:
- 实时地图显示骑手位置
- 预计送达时间(ETA)动态更新
- 订单状态通知(接单、取货、配送中、完成)
- 评价与反馈:
- 骑手/商家评分
- 投诉与建议入口
- 历史订单查询与发票申请
2. 骑手端功能
- 接单系统:
- 智能派单(基于位置、订单优先级、骑手评分)
- 手动抢单模式(可选)
- 订单详情查看(商品、地址、备注)
- 导航与路线优化:
- 集成高德/百度地图API
- 多订单路径规划(顺路单合并)
- 实时交通信息反馈
- 收入统计:
- 当日/周/月收入明细
- 提现功能(绑定银行卡/第三方支付)
3. 商家端功能
- 商品管理:
- 上下架、库存预警
- 价格/规格调整
- 图片与描述编辑
- 订单处理:
- 自动接单/手动接单切换
- 打印小票(连接蓝牙打印机)
- 异常订单处理(退单、缺货)
- 数据看板:
- 销售统计(时段/商品维度)
- 用户评价分析
- 营业时间设置
4. 后台管理系统
- 用户管理:
- 用户/骑手/商家认证审核
- 封禁/解封操作
- 分级权限控制
- 订单调度:
- 异常订单人工干预
- 紧急订单加急处理
- 区域运力监控
- 数据分析:
- 订单热力图(高峰区域/时段)
- 用户行为分析(复购率、客单价)
- 财务报表生成(佣金、结算)
二、技术实现方案
1. 技术栈选择
- 前端:
- 用户端:React Native/Flutter(跨平台)
- 管理后台:Vue.js/React + Ant Design
- 后端:
- 框架:Spring Boot(Java)/Django(Python)/Node.js
- 数据库:MySQL(关系型)+ MongoDB(日志/地理位置)
- 缓存:Redis(订单状态、会话管理)
- 第三方服务:
- 地图:高德/百度地图API
- 支付:支付宝/微信支付SDK
- 短信:阿里云/腾讯云短信服务
- 推送:极光推送/个推
2. 关键技术点
- 实时定位:
- 使用WebSocket或MQTT协议实现骑手位置实时上报
- 地理围栏技术(如进入/离开配送区域触发通知)
- 路径规划:
- 调用地图API的路径规划接口
- 自定义算法优化多订单配送路径
- 高并发处理:
- 订单抢单场景使用Redis分布式锁
- 消息队列(RabbitMQ/Kafka)处理异步任务
3. 部署方案
- 云服务:阿里云/腾讯云/AWS
- 容器化:Docker + Kubernetes(弹性伸缩)
- CDN加速:静态资源(图片、JS/CSS)全球分发
三、开发流程
1. 需求分析(1-2周):
- 竞品调研(美团、饿了么、达达)
- 用户访谈(商家、骑手、消费者)
- 功能优先级排序(MVP最小可行产品)
2. 原型设计(1周):
- 使用Figma/Axure制作高保真原型
- 用户流程图(下单→支付→配送→完成)
3. 技术开发(8-12周):
- 敏捷开发(Scrum模式,2周一个迭代)
- 代码审查(GitLab CI/CD流水线)
4. 测试阶段(2-3周):
- 单元测试(JUnit/pytest)
- 压测(JMeter模拟10万级并发)
- 用户内测(邀请100-500名真实用户)
5. 上线运营:
- 分阶段发布(灰度发布策略)
- 监控系统(Prometheus + Grafana)
- 应急预案(熔断机制、降级方案)
四、运营策略
1. 冷启动方案:
- 商家端:免费入驻+流量扶持
- 骑手端:高额补贴(前100单免佣金)
- 用户端:首单立减15元(裂变分享)
2. 增长策略:
- 社交裂变:邀请好友得红包
- 会员体系:付费会员免配送费
- 异业合作:与超市/药店/花店联合推广
3. 风险控制:
- 骑手背景审查(与第三方征信合作)
- 订单保险(配送途中商品损坏赔付)
- 合规性:取得《网络预约出租汽车经营许可证》
五、成本估算(以一线城市为例)
| 项目 | 费用范围 |
|---------------|----------------|
| 开发团队 | 50-100万(6个月) |
| 服务器费用 | 5-10万/年 |
| 第三方服务 | 3-5万/年 |
| 营销推广 | 20-50万/季度 |
| 总计 | 100-200万(首年) |
六、案例参考
- 闪送:专注即时配送,通过“一对一急送”差异化竞争
- 达达快送:众包模式+商超合作,日均订单超500万
- 顺丰同城:依托顺丰物流体系,主打高端配送市场
七、进阶功能(二期开发)
1. 智能预测:
- 基于历史数据预测区域订单量
- 动态调整骑手调度策略
2. 无人配送:
- 接入自动驾驶车辆/无人机
- 特殊场景(校园、园区)试点
3. 碳中和功能:
- 骑手配送路径优化减少空驶
- 用户选择“绿色配送”可获积分
开发建议:初期聚焦核心功能(下单、配送、支付),通过快速迭代验证商业模式,再逐步扩展功能。同时需密切关注《电子商务法》《数据安全法》等法规要求,确保合规运营。